A machining technician is an entry-level manufacturing position. As a machining technician, your duties vary depending on the type of production but commonly involve maintenance and repair of equipment. You must often troubleshoot machine failures to determine the cause with the least amount of downtime. Your responsibilities also include performing calibration of new devices, testing new processes, and conducting diagnostic testing. Some machining technician jobs involve disassembly and installation of new equipment, which requires proficiency with a variety of tools and technologies including CNC programming.
